THE STUDY ON LARGE SCALE CITY 3D SCENE RENDERING

The paper researched on rendering art of large scale 3D city sight, and accomplished spatio-temporal data model of city objects taking geometry and action data into account integrated; Referred to the idea of LOD algorithm of terrain quadtree, constituted scene quadtree, and improve search and cull efficiency of discrete city objects; proposed and accomplished a fast collision detection algorithm base on Z_BUFFER value, this method take full advantage of transform matrix and depth information, accomplished fast collision detection and response when user roaming in the fictitious scene as first person. Integrate these technologies, accomplished real time dynamic rendering of large scale 3D city scene.
